The Setup Struggle: GoHighLevel for Small Service Businesses Setting up GoHighLevel can be a daunting task for small service business owners like Kevin, who are searching for the best CRM for small service businesses to streamline their customer relations and marketing efforts. Despite its promise as an all-in-one solution, the platform often leaves users tangled in a web of complex features and technical hurdles, making it challenging to learn how to automate customer follow-up in a service business without a dedicated IT team.

The primary cause of this pain lies in GoHighLevel’s robust feature set, which, while comprehensive, can be challenging for those not well-versed in digital marketing or CRM systems. The platform offers everything from CRM integrations and automated workflows to AI-driven marketing tools, but this vast array of options can feel more like a maze than a path to growth. The vendor's website touts its AI-powered capabilities and broad feature set, but for small business owners, this can translate into a steep learning curve where each tool requires time and expertise to master.

Moreover, GoHighLevel’s onboarding process doesn’t fully alleviate these challenges. While the company offers numerous tutorials and a community of users, these resources sometimes fall short in providing the hands-on guidance necessary for small business owners who are juggling multiple roles. As a result, the setup phase can become a time-consuming bottleneck, delaying the benefits that the platform promises.

The impact on Kevin's business is significant. Every hour spent grappling with the setup is an hour not spent on generating leads or serving customers. This inefficiency can lead to missed sales opportunities and potential revenue loss, not to mention the frustration of dealing with technical issues instead of focusing on business growth. For businesses operating on tight margins, the inability to quickly and effectively implement a new system can be a costly setback.

There are alternative approaches available that can simplify this process. While GoHighLevel seeks to be a comprehensive solution, other platforms prioritize intuitive design and streamlined setup processes, making them more accessible to small businesses without extensive technical resources.

These alternatives often focus on core functionalities, ensuring that essential tools are easy to access and implement. By reducing the complexity and tailoring the user experience to the needs of small business owners, these solutions allow you to hit the ground running with minimal setup time, freeing you to concentrate on driving your business forward.
